h3 id="whatwhat-iswhat-exactly-is-aan-registered-agent">What an Registered Agent?</h3>
p>One registered agent refers to the designated entity or company nominated to handle legal documents and official correspondence on behalf of a specific business entity. These include documents like service of process, tax notices, and other important legal documents. The registered agent serves as the responsible party for making sure that a business remains compliant with state regulations and maintains important legal connections.</p>
p>Registered agents play a crucial service for both corporations and limited liability companies (LLCs). They render a critical service by assisting businesses receive and manage legal notifications. By designating a registered agent, companies ensure they possess a reliable point of contact for state officials and legal purposes, protecting their interests and maintaining good standing within the jurisdiction in which they operate.</p>
p>In many states, having established a registered agent is a legal requirement for forming a business entity. This ensures that businesses can be contacted during regular business hours, which aids in the timely handling of legal matters. Whether a business is local or functions nationwide, selecting a reliable registered agent is essential for efficient legal operation and compliance with statutory obligations.</p>

h3 id="registered-agent-requirements">Registered Agent Requirements</h3>
p>To establish your business as a formal entity, it is essential to designate a registered agent. A registered agent serves as the primary point of contact for legal documents, such as service of process notifications, subpoenas, and other significant correspondence. Most states require that every business entity, including LLCs and corporations, appoint a registered agent who is a legal inhabitant of the state in which the business is formed. This guarantees that there is a reliable individual or entity available to receive critical legal documents on behalf of the business.</p>
p>In addition to being a state resident, registered agents must have a tangible address for the registered office where legal documents can be sent. This cannot be a P.O. Box; it must be a physical location that is open during normal business hours. It's also important for registered agents to maintain availability to receive documents promptly. Not having a designated registered agent or neglecting this responsibility can result in legal complications, including fines or the inability to defend against lawsuits.</p>
p>Furthermore, registered agent requirements may vary from state to state. Businesses should check their specific state's regulations to ensure adherence. Some states also allow businesses to hire a professional registered agent, which can be advantageous for confidentiality and ease. These professional registered agent services can manage compliance reminders and handle legal documents securely, making them a popular choice for many businesses looking to streamline their operations.</p>
h3 id="cost-of-registered-agent-services">Cost of Registered Agent Services</h3>
p>The registered agent services can vary widely depending on several factors, which include the company offering the service, the level of services offered, and the jurisdiction in which your business operates. Most registered agent companies charge a subscription fee, which might range from roughly $50 to a few hundred dollars. When considering costs, it is important to assess the components of the service package, as some providers may offer extra perks, like annual reminders for compliance or business mail forwarding, which can justify higher fees.</p>
p>Affordable registered agent solutions are out there, especially if you conduct thorough research and comparisons different registered agent companies. A number of firms choose agents that provide services across states that work in various states, while some may choose local registered agents for more personalized services. It is valuable to find a balance between cost with reliability, as a low-cost registered agent might not offer the equivalent level of service or effectiveness in managing important legal documents.</p>
